Elahe Massumi's installation work, The Hijras examines
rituals and rites of passages that are inconceivable and archaic in
the contemporary world. The tales of emasculated men and their
acquiring divine status is encountered throughout both fiction and
non-fiction literature and it fills our imagination. However, the
choice of the Hijras as the subject matter for this work goes beyond
simple curiosity. More than offering commiseration, Massumi opens to
her public the possibility of going beyond the purely tangible and
visual. Her work invites the viewer to enter into a more extreme
space, an off-planet location in contemporary art, from where no one
leaves undisturbed.
